Description:

Manufactured in 1894, the top of the barrel has the standard two-line address and patent dates ending in 1888. The left of the barrel is marked "COLT. D.A. 38". The left rear of the frame is marked with the circled Rampant Colt. The assembly number "329" is on the frame, cranes, and cylinder latch. The back strap is inscribed "Maj. A.K.A Liebich, 5th Regt. O.V.I.". The serial number is on the butt along with the inscription "Cleveland, Ohio." Major Arthur Liebich was in command of the 3rd Battalion, 5th Ohio Volunteer Infantry Regiment during the Spanish-American War. The regiment was one of many formed from volunteers who answered the call during the conflict with the Spanish. The regiment was transferred to Florida in preparation for transport to Cuba but an armistice was reached before they embarked. Includes a leather military pattern holster, a hardwood and glass display case, and a binder of information related to Liebich's service.

Rating Definition:

Fine, retains 75% of the period refinished blue finish with the balance having thinned to mostly a smooth grey patina. The grips are also fine with some light wear and scattered light handling marks. Mechanically excellent.
